summ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Jens Georg <mail@jensge.org>2016-10-15 20:42:44 +0200
committerJens Georg <mail@jensge.org>2016-10-15 20:42:44 +0200
commit71f69cf8886332f7677ffdb67eecc24c90b0e7b7 (patch)
tree6389109b46371538d69392676396b2b7a594f89e
parent5a232ff64cbb4bc1ae8bb6d6163f60124fb8f186 (diff)
downloadgssdp-71f69cf8886332f7677ffdb67eecc24c90b0e7b7.tar.gz
Fix out-of-tree builds
Signed-off-by: Jens Georg <mail@jensge.org>
-rw-r--r--examples/Makefile.am2
-rw-r--r--libgssdp/Makefile.am6
-rw-r--r--libgssdp/gssdp.h10
3 files changed, 9 insertions, 9 deletions
diff --git a/examples/Makefile.am b/examples/Makefile.am
index bc68d46..2b23cb6 100644
--- a/examples/Makefile.am
+++ b/examples/Makefile.am
@@ -1,4 +1,4 @@
-AM_CFLAGS = $(LIBGSSDP_CFLAGS) -I$(top_srcdir)
+AM_CFLAGS = $(LIBGSSDP_CFLAGS) -I$(top_srcdir) -I$(top_builddir)
noinst_PROGRAMS = test-browser test-publish
diff --git a/libgssdp/Makefile.am b/libgssdp/Makefile.am
index b37e691..c888f0e 100644
--- a/libgssdp/Makefile.am
+++ b/libgssdp/Makefile.am
@@ -10,7 +10,7 @@
LTVERSION = 0:0:0
-AM_CFLAGS = $(LIBGSSDP_CFLAGS) -I$(top_srcdir) $(WARN_CFLAGS)
+AM_CFLAGS = $(LIBGSSDP_CFLAGS) -I$(top_srcdir) -I$(top_builddir) $(WARN_CFLAGS)
libgssdpincdir = $(includedir)/gssdp-1.2/libgssdp
@@ -110,13 +110,13 @@ INTROSPECTION_SCANNER_ARGS = \
--add-include-path=$(top_srcdir) \
--pkg-export=gssdp-1.2 \
$(WARN_SCANNERFLAGS)
-INTROSPECTION_COMPILER_ARGS = --includedir=$(top_srcdir)
+INTROSPECTION_COMPILER_ARGS = --includedir=$(top_srcdir) --includedir=$(top_builddir)
if HAVE_INTROSPECTION
GSSDP-1.2.gir: libgssdp-1.2.la
GSSDP_1_2_gir_INCLUDES = GObject-2.0 Gio-2.0 Soup-2.4
-GSSDP_1_2_gir_CFLAGS = $(INCLUDES)
+GSSDP_1_2_gir_CFLAGS = $(AM_CFLAGS)
GSSDP_1_2_gir_LIBS = libgssdp-1.2.la
GSSDP_1_2_gir_FILES = $(introspection_sources)
GSSDP_1_2_gir_NAMESPACE = GSSDP
diff --git a/libgssdp/gssdp.h b/libgssdp/gssdp.h
index 4c35d11..2cd9087 100644
--- a/libgssdp/gssdp.h
+++ b/libgssdp/gssdp.h
@@ -19,8 +19,8 @@
* Boston, MA 02110-1301, USA.
*/
-#include "gssdp-client.h"
-#include "gssdp-error.h"
-#include "gssdp-resource-browser.h"
-#include "gssdp-resource-group.h"
-#include "gssdp-enums.h"
+#include <libgssdp/gssdp-client.h>
+#include <libgssdp/gssdp-error.h>
+#include <libgssdp/gssdp-resource-browser.h>
+#include <libgssdp/gssdp-resource-group.h>
+#include <libgssdp/gssdp-enums.h>